Though it has to forever compete with The Searchers and High Noon, few Western films will ever have the impact of The Good, The Bad and The Ugly, the final film in Sergio Leone’s “Dollars Trilogy” and the most famous Spaghetti Western (that is, films in the American Western style made by Italian directors) of all time. It catapulted Clint Eastwood to super-stardom, changed the way countless directors thought about the genre, and continues to influence film to this day. It’s a classic line from Monty Python’s Life of Brian – ‘What have the Romans ever done for us?’ Well now, alongside sanitation, education, irrigation and roads it seems they also created the first practical joke device. An incredible fourth-century Tanatalus bowl that soaked unsuspecting dinner party guests in wine could have been the earliest prankster device. The find, which is the first known example of a ‘greedy cup’, could even have been enjoyed by Roman emperors. ‘This is the earliest example of a physical practical joke, certainly for the Romans,’ said Dr Richard Hobbs, curator of Roman Britain at the … Continue reading →
